The players and backroom staff of Asante Kotoko are reportedly responding to treament at the Komfo Anokye Teaching Hospital.
The team bus of the Porcupine Warriors reportedly rammed into a slow moving truck loaded with fertiliser, around 10pm at Nkawkaw on their way to Kumasi, the Ashanti Region capital.
